ăpūs (noun M) = ἄπους: (footless)
* A kind of swallow, said to have no feet, the black martin: Hirundo apus, Linn.; Plin. 10, 39, 55, § 144.
Charlton T. Lewis, Charles Short, A Latin Dictionary
